Workers affected by floods may qualify for unemployment insurance

Workers who have lost employment due to flooding across the state may qualify for Unemployment Insurance (UI) payments and should visit www.jobsnd.com or call 701-328-4995 for more information and to file a claim.

As an example, employees of businesses that have been closed due to flooding or preventive efforts may qualify for UI payments.

Job Service North Dakota, the agency that administers UI in the state, assists employers and workers with issues related to unemployment. At this time, other disaster-related relief, such as loss of business income, is not available through Job Service.

If the disasters worsen, Disaster Unemployment Assistance (DUA) may be added to the current disaster declaration, which would provide UI benefits for qualifying business owners who otherwise may be ineligible for regular UI. Job Service will issue a public notice if DUA benefits become available.

For other flood or disaster-related relief, please call the N.D. Department of Emergency Services at 701-328-8100.
